Overnight Boarding
Overnight boarding is available depending on scheduled events. All overnight boarders are placed in the show stalls. The owner must supply buckets, feed and bedding. Shavings are available for purchase at $8.00 per bag. All overnights are $15.00 per night, per horse, per stall. Please call ahead for reservations. A current Coggins test (within the last 6 months) is required prior to horse entering barn.

The two arenas north of the boarding barns, the round pen, and the dressage ring above the round pen are part of the boarding barn area and are available for use by the boarders (with the exception of a few events at the facility that require the use of one or more of these arenas). There is access from the barn area to the trail system and the cross country course. The stadium, indoor arena and the arenas below the indoor are available for use when events are not in progress.

Training is not provided by the barn but can be contracted separately with the trainers that board and/or train here at the facility. All trainers are required to file certain insurance requirements prior to teaching at this facility and are required to pay a per lesson training fee. Anyone that hauls into the facility who is not a current boarder must pay a $5.00 per horse haul in/parking fee. Use of the cross country course is not included - a separate fee and signed release are required for such use.
